As for a sire who produces a small number of puppies with a particular fault, that is called luck! With the simple genes, not the complex ones with varying factors and mutations etc... but the simple ones like coat and missing teeth...either you carry it or you dont. There is no such thing as a male who carries "a light coat factor", because he has only produced a handful of coats...the percentages on genetics are based on 100 puppies out of the same combination, and usually it works out about right if you have a nice big litter, but it is possible to breed a male to a coat and get 10 pups with no coats and then assume he does not carry it,and then repeat it and get all coats! It has happened...unless you have either 100 puppies out of the same sire and dam, or the marker is identified and tested for, you cannot be 100% certain anyway. So if a male has thrown a few coats out of 10 litters, or had a few missing teeth in a few litters, all it means is he carries it and you have been either lucky, or most of the bitches he was bred to did not carry it. If you bred him to 10 bitches who all had missing teeth, or you knew carried it, you would get missing teeth in all of the litters.
